Advertencia: esta página es una traducción automática (automática), en caso de dudas, consulte el documento original en inglés. Disculpe las molestias que esto pueda causar.
ECTtracker
Descripción general de ECTtracker
ECTtracker (EyeComTec Tracker) es un programa de seguimiento ocular que funciona junto con aplicaciones para capturar videos y controlar programas. En función del estado del ojo (abierto, cerrado, un ojo abierto), transmite los códigos de las teclas de control al programa receptor. Por lo tanto, el usuario puede ejecutar el programa y escribir el texto abriendo y cerrando los ojos. No requiere instalación y tiene opciones de configuración flexibles.
Sobre ECTtracker
ECTtracker (EyeComTec Tracker) - es un software de seguimiento ocular, que permite identificar el estado actual de los ojos del usuario (abierto o cerrado). Este software se puede usar junto con diferentes aplicaciones de captura de video para cámaras web u otros dispositivos conectados a la PC (p. Ej. ECTcamera, Skype, Reproductor multimedia). ECTtracker asigna diferentes estados de los ojos del usuario con códigos clave seleccionados, que pueden transmitirse a cualquier otra aplicación de control (ECTkeyboard, ECTmorse y muchos otros). Este programa es realmente flexible y ajustable, así como portativo y puede personalizarse para cualquier usuario específico y características de rendimiento de la computadora. De hecho, ECTtracker es una forma alternativa de realización de visión inteligente por computadora.
A diferencia de muchos otros programas con una funcionalidad similar, ECTtracker analiza imágenes utilizando la matriz especial de muestras, que es única para cualquier usuario y entorno específicos (posición de la cámara, condiciones de iluminación, etc.). El programa puede ser utilizado tanto por pacientes totalmente paralizados como por aquellos que sufren de actividad muscular incontrolable (temblores, tics). ECTtracker proporciona un seguimiento seguro del estado actual del ojo incluso para aquellos pacientes con daños físicos en la cara: lesiones, quemaduras o estados postoperatorios.
El programa es realmente flexible y personalizable. El usuario puede establecer la estructura de reconocimiento de imagen, el nivel de coincidencia entre imágenes y muestras, la velocidad de procesamiento de video (en cuadros por segundo), el tiempo de inactividad para los casos en que no se transmiten imágenes y códigos clave a aplicaciones de control de terceros. El software contiene más de 50 parámetros diferentes, que pueden usarse para cambiar la apariencia y la funcionalidad de ECTtracker. Algunos parámetros permiten al usuario reducir los requisitos informáticos, proporcionando un trabajo estable incluso en computadoras con bajos niveles de rendimiento.
ECTtracker tiene una interfaz realmente conveniente y una funcionalidad de alcance para una configuración adecuada y precisa y procedimientos de depuración. El procedimiento de configuración inicial es realmente fácil debido a la función de calibración automática. Además, ECTtracker admite varias localizaciones, lo que permite a los pacientes utilizar software en su propio idioma nativo.
ECTtracker es una aplicación muy práctica y conveniente debido a su capacidad de adaptarse a la condición física del usuario y a los diferentes entornos y recursos del sistema informático. Un proceso de configuración flexible y una cantidad ilimitada de cuentas de usuario hace posible utilizar la aplicación en todas las condiciones.
Todos los elementos principales de la interfaz y un ejemplo de su posicionamiento se muestran en la fig. 1)
La interfaz estándar de ECTtracker Pro sin la ventana de configuración del programa se muestra en la imagen. Las cifras numeradas muestran:
- 1 - la ventana principal de ECTtracker, que muestra la parte procesada de la imagen, la estructura de reconocimiento y los campos estadísticos;
- 2 - la forma de captura, o la llamada "ventana de destino", que permite a la aplicación capturar una parte de la imagen para su análisis.
- 3 - la ventana de ECTcamera que se usa para capturar la imagen.
- 4 - la matriz de muestras - una tabla especial de ECTtracker aplicaciones, que contiene pequeñas instantáneas de muestra con los ojos del usuario en diferentes estados (ambos ojos abiertos o cerrados, o solo un ojo abierto). El programa admite muestras y estructuras de reconocimiento para uno o ambos ojos. Durante su funcionamiento, el software compara muestras y la imagen actual, identificando así el estado actual de los ojos.
- 5 - la ventana de intensidad del canal. En esta ventana, los canales, que tienen los cambios de valor más altos para diferentes imágenes, se muestran en un diagrama rojo y superior.
- 6 - la ventana de depuración con indicadores gráficos de bandas. Al cambiar el color de la franja, el software muestra claramente qué fila de la matriz de muestras corresponde con la imagen adquirida. Esta ventana se utiliza durante la configuración inicial de ECTtracker y durante la determinación de la calidad del seguimiento;
- PRO7 - la ventana SCO9, que muestra el nivel de intensidad de los cambios de cada punto de la estructura de reconocimiento. Esta ventana está destinada a usuarios más avanzados, que pueden editar el archivo de estructura de reconocimiento.
- PRO8 - el registro del programa, que contiene información sobre todas las acciones y eventos importantes. El registro contiene la fecha y la hora de inicio y detención del seguimiento, la selección de la estructura y algunos otros datos. Toda la información se puede exportar como un archivo de texto.
Se puede encontrar información más detallada sobre los elementos 4-8 en el Elementos de depuración sección de este manual.
Ventajas de usar ECTtracker
En comparación con los productos de software de otras compañías con una funcionalidad similar, ECTtracker tiene una gama de ventajas significativas:
- La adaptación del programa a las necesidades específicas de la condición física de cada usuario individual. ECTtracker puede trabajar con pacientes totalmente paralizados y con diversos trastornos de la actividad motora.
- La completa capacidad de entrenamiento. El programa permite al usuario trabajar en prácticamente cualquier entorno: posición de la cámara, iluminación, posición del usuario. ECTtracker rastrea el estado del ojo del usuario comparándolo con muestras guardadas, proporcionando una alta calidad de seguimiento y operación estable.
- La amplia gama de algoritmos diferentes. El programa involucra no solo un sistema de color RGB para el análisis de imágenes, sino también un sistema HSL, que es más similar a la visión humana. El usuario puede seleccionar el nivel de prioridad para cada uno de los canales, aumentando así la calidad general de reconocimiento. ECTtracker puede establecer la prioridad del canal automáticamente después de llenar la matriz de muestras.
- La cantidad ilimitada de configuraciones. El programa permite guardar configuraciones en archivos separados y cambiarlas sobre la marcha cuando sea necesario. El tamaño muy ligero de dichos archivos permite al usuario almacenarlos en cualquier dispositivo portátil y compartirlos por correo electrónico.
- La portabilidad y el pequeño tamaño del programa permiten al usuario ejecutarlo desde cualquier dispositivo de almacenamiento externo. ECTtracker no requiere instalación y no cambia el registro del sistema operativo.
- rica personalización y requisitos técnicos promedio. ECTtracker proporciona un trabajo estable incluso en computadoras de gama baja debido a su capacidad de deshabilitar elementos.
- Configuración flexible y soporte de estructuras de reconocimiento personalizadas. Los usuarios más avanzados pueden cambiar los archivos de estructura de reconocimiento e incluso seleccionar el nivel de prioridad para cada uno de sus puntos.
- localizaciones El programa admite varios idiomas de interfaz, que proporcionan un alto nivel de comodidad y permiten al usuario trabajar con el programa en su propio idioma.
- La interfaz simple e intuitiva permite al usuario familiarizarse con el programa muy rápidamente y cambiar todas las configuraciones fácilmente.
La característica principal de ECTtracker es la adaptación a las habilidades físicas del usuario. El programa puede ser utilizado tanto por pacientes totalmente paralizados como por aquellos que sufren de actividad muscular incontrolable (temblores, tics). En caso de uso de un marcador de contraste, ECTtracker proporciona la calidad adecuada incluso para aquellos pacientes con daños físicos en la cara: heridas, quemaduras, pestañas chamuscadas o afecciones oculares postoperatorias. La capacidad de cambiar el nivel de coincidencia entre la imagen analizada y las muestras, así como una amplia selección de estructuras y algunos otros parámetros, permiten al usuario ajustar ECTtracker para necesidades específicas y resultados de seguimiento óptimos.
Una diferencia favorable de ECTtracker en comparación con un software similar es su total capacidad de entrenamiento, que permite a los usuarios en cualquier estado físico trabajar con el programa. El algoritmo de seguimiento de ECTtracker trabaja independientemente a la posición del usuario, iluminación o parámetros técnicos de la computadora. Hoy en día, la mayoría de los algoritmos utilizan partes claras y oscuras de la imagen para el análisis, mientras que ECTtracker permite al usuario crear una base de muestras para el seguimiento, que son únicas para cada usuario y entorno (incluida la iluminación o la posición de la cámara). Un nivel tan alto de capacidad de entrenamiento proporciona una alta calidad de seguimiento en casi cualquier caso. Como resultado, el usuario puede trabajar con el teclado virtual con mayor confianza y rapidez, creando menos estrés al mismo tiempo. Además, ECTtracker permite al usuario ingresar símbolos no solo parpadeando, sino con cualquier movimiento o gesto claramente visible en el marco. Esta característica puede ser utilizada por pacientes con una amplia variedad de limitaciones de actividad física.
Todos los cambios de configuración realizados por el usuario se pueden guardar como archivos de configuración separados, lo que permite cambiar dichos archivos "sobre la marcha", lo que permite a diferentes usuarios trabajar en la misma máquina. Las estructuras de reconocimiento y la configuración personal se ajustan a las necesidades específicas de cada usuario. El programa permite al usuario crear una cantidad ilimitada de perfiles de configuración, mientras que el tamaño ligero de esos archivos le permite al usuario enviarlos por correo electrónico o de cualquier otra manera.
La portabilidad y el pequeño tamaño del programa permiten al usuario ejecutarlo desde cualquier medio externo. ECTtracker no requiere instalación y no realiza cambios en el registro del sistema operativo.
Los campos de información de la ventana principal del programa, las ventanas de depuración adicionales y el registro detallado de eventos son características útiles para el ajuste fino. Al mismo tiempo, todos los elementos de depuración se pueden deshabilitar durante el funcionamiento normal del programa. La capacidad de reducir la cantidad de fotogramas procesados por segundo puede reducir la carga en el procesador y otros recursos del sistema de la computadora. Esto permite al usuario ajustar ECTtracker para un trabajo cómodo incluso en computadoras con bajo rendimiento.
La interfaz simple y fácil de usar le permite al usuario realizar el procedimiento de configuración inicial realmente rápido y comenzar a trabajar con ECTtracker. Toda la funcionalidad básica del menú principal está duplicada con "teclas de acceso rápido" para una gestión rápida. Adicionalmente, ECTtracker admite diferentes localizaciones, lo que permite a los usuarios trabajar con el programa en su idioma nativo.
La configuración de ECTtracker No tomará mucho tiempo. En caso de cambios en las condiciones de iluminación o en la posición del paciente, el usuario puede crear nuevas muestras para un seguimiento realmente rápido utilizando la función de calibración automática. No es necesario eliminar muestras antiguas, porque el programa permite al usuario guardar y cargar una cantidad ilimitada de perfiles de configuración.
Todas estas características proporcionan una flexibilidad extrema en la configuración y operación de ECTtracker.